IT Project Managers work closely with upper management to ensure that information technology projects remain on schedule and within the limits of the specified budget. They measure project performance and manage any changes made to the scope. They may also recruit employees, create milestones, assign tasks to teams and manage the use of resources.
While there is no specific academic path to becoming an IT Project Manager, most employers typically require that candidates for the position have several years of experience supervising projects. Having a degree in computer science or a related field is also considered a strong plus. Successful IT Project Managers are capable of multitasking, thinking critically and supervising teams.
Ranked in the 2017 Global Financial Centres Index, as one of the top 10 competitive financial centers in the world, Chicago is a major business and finance capital. It also has a competitive tech cluster. In 2014, the city had the third-largest science and engineering workforce in the country. Chicago’s balanced economy is made up of strong tech, manufacturing, food processing, publishing and finance sectors. The city also houses the headquarters of several major retailers, including Sears, Walgreens and Ace Hardware.
A huge, vibrant city, Chicago is serviced by an efficient train network, although a large percentage of the population prefers the convenience of driving. In addition, thousands of workers in Downtown Chicago rely on a popular pedway system—a series of overhead bridges and underground tunnels that links over three dozen blocks—to get around during cooler weather.
